Franklin Mosher Baldwin Memorial Fellowships, 02/00
Franklin Mosher Baldwin Memorial Fellowships, 02/00
This fellowship is intended for scholars and students
with citizenship in an African country who seek to
obtain an advanced degree or specialized training in
an area of study related to human origins research.
This award is for a program of approved special training
and/or advanced training towards an MA, PhD, or equivalent
and is limited to two years of support. The applicant
must have a home sponsor who is a member of the institution
where the applicant is affiliated in the home country
as well as a host sponsor who is a member of the institution
in which the candidate plans to pursue training. Should
an award be made, the host sponsor must be willing
to assume responsibility for overseeing the candidate's
training. Since this fellowship is intended to be a
partnership between the candidate and both the home
and host institutions, it is expected that candidates
will be offered support by these institutions in the
form of financial assistance and, upon completion of
training, employment in the home country. Contact:
